Rob Zombie’s 3 From Hell poster promises murder, madness and mayhem

August 26, 2019 by Amie Cranswick

A new poster has arrived online for director Rob Zombie’s latest horror 3 From Hell featuring Baby (Sheri Moon Zombie), Otis (Bill Moseley) and Foxy (Richard Brake); take a look here…

3 From Hell is set for release on October 31st, and features the returning Sheri Moon Zombie (Baby), Bill Moseley (Otis), Sid Haig (Captain Spaulding), Daniel Roebuck (Morris Green) and Danny Trejo (Rondo) alongside Jeff Daniel Philips (The Lords of Salem), Clint Howard (The Lords of Salem), Austin Stoker (Assault on Precinct 13), Dee Wallace (Cujo), David Ury (31), Dot-Marie Jones (American Horror Story) and Tom Papa (El Superbeasto).
